In shop advised me for my issue to buy EAP110. Based now on searching on web/forums it seems is not suitable for what I need it. My need is that from my balcony I connect to open free public wi-fi, so that with 'antenna' connect to signal and then behind from antenna go LAN to router in house who will share internet. I was trying to set up EAP110 to work like that and come only to step where seen others wifi (Rogue AP detection), put them on Trusted and this is it. Should  it bought extender instead EAP110?

The 110 is just an AP (access point).  You need a device that can act as either a wifi to ethernet bridge (wifi client), or as a wifi epeater...neither of which the 110 is capable of.  Take it back to the store.

Have a look at the TPlink RE450.. It will join the outdoor wifi and it has a side GigE port to connect to your router.
